Reputable firm in Wigan are currently seeking a Solicitor to join their Motor Finance and Asset Recovery Team. This role presents an excellent opportunity for a motivated individual to contribute to this dynamic team and make a significant impact in the field of debt recovery.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age a caseload of motor finance and asset recovery matters, including debt collection, repossession, and enforcement actions.
  • Conduct legal research, draft legal documents, and provide strategic advice to clients on debt recovery strategies.
  • Provide comprehensive support to senior solicitors and legal professionals within the team, assisting with case preparation, court proceedings, and documentation.
  • Liaise with clients, creditors, and external stakeholders to gather relevant information and documentation.
  • Ensure compliance with all relevant laws, regulations, and procedural guidelines in motor finance and asset recovery matters.
  • Stay abreast of changes in legislation and industry best practices, providing guidance to clients and internal teams as needed.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, providing high-quality legal advice and exceptional client service.
  • Attend client meetings, negotiate settlements, and represent clients in court proceedings as required.
